Latest Patents
Matthew holds a patent for a "System and method for determining a weight of an arriving aircraft." This invention involves a method for receiving data related to an aircraft landing at an airport. The data includes the aircraft type and information about the owner or operator, while excluding a unique identifier for the aircraft. The system retrieves additional data related to the aircraft, including its landing weight, and reports this information to the airport operator. This innovation is crucial for improving landing procedures and ensuring safety at airports.
